Perguntas com a marcação «entity-framework»

Um ORM criado pela Microsoft e está disponível como parte do .Net framework 3.5 e posterior.



5
MVC, WCF, EF, LINQ - Sou apenas eu? [fechadas]
Fechadas. Esta questão está fora de tópico . No momento, não está aceitando respostas. Deseja melhorar esta pergunta? Atualize a pergunta para que ela esteja no tópico do Software Engineering Stack Exchange. Fechado há 8 anos . ... ou as coisas estão ficando mais complicadas? Parece-me que você precisa saber …

7
O CodeFirst é destinado a aplicativos de grande escala?
Estive lendo o Entity Framework, em particular, o EF 4.1 e seguindo este link ( http://weblogs.asp.net/scottgu/archive/2010/07/16/code-first-development-with-entity- framework-4.aspx ) e seu guia sobre o Code First. Acho que é legal, mas eu estava pensando: o Code First deveria ser apenas uma solução para o desenvolvimento rápido, onde você pode entrar sem …





3
Estrutura de entidades e separação de camadas
Estou tentando trabalhar um pouco com o Entity Framework e tenho uma pergunta sobre a separação de camadas. Eu costumo usar a interface do usuário -> BLL -> DAL abordagem e estou querendo saber como usar EF aqui. Meu DAL normalmente seria algo como GetPerson(id) { // some sql return …

5
Se o Padrão de Repositório é um exagero para ORMs modernas (EF, nHibernate), o que é uma abstração melhor?
Recentemente, li muitos argumentos contra o uso do padrão de repositório com ORMs poderosos, como o Entity Framework, pois ele incorpora funcionalidade semelhante a repositório, juntamente com a funcionalidade Unidade de Trabalho. Outro argumento contra o uso do padrão para uma situação como teste de unidade é que o padrão …


1
Separando o ASP.NET IdentityUser das minhas outras entidades
Eu tenho uma ProjectName.Corebiblioteca contendo toda a minha lógica de negócios, minhas entidades e seu comportamento. Atualmente, não há nenhuma relação com o Entity Framework ou qualquer outro DAL, porque eu gosto de manter essas coisas separadas. As configurações do Entity Framework (usando a API Fluent) residem em um ProjectName.Infrastructureprojeto, …


3
Em termos de arquitetura, uma camada de abstração de banco de dados, como o Entity Framework da Microsoft, anula a necessidade de uma Camada de Acesso a Dados separada?
Do jeito que era Durante anos, organizei minhas soluções de software da seguinte forma: Data Access Layer (DAL) para abstrair o negócio de acessar dados Business Logic Layer (BLL) para aplicar regras de negócios a conjuntos de dados, manipular autenticação etc. Utilitários (Util), que é apenas uma biblioteca de métodos …


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.